Rating Lithuania team is a part of the Rating and Financial Analysis Department, consisting of about 60 employees working across several countries. You will be located in Vilnius and collaborate with colleagues in Scandinavia.

You will be part of the team that is responsible for credit ratings of a wide range of financial institutions, including banks, insurance companies, investment funds, etc. This team is essential in maintaining business relationships between the bank and these financial institutions.

Depending on your experience, you may be offered a different seniority of the role.

"We believe that the most valuable asset is human potential."

You will:

  • Analyse information about financial institutions from various sources, such as financial statements, annual reports, internal systems, relationship managers, rating agencies, and other external sources
  • Use the information about the financial institution, financial analysis skills, and different rating models to assess credit quality and assign ratings
  • Document your findings in internal systems following Danske Bank’s requirements by preparing rating proposals based on information about the analysed financial institution
  • Monitor changes in the economic/operating environment and, if necessary, adjust the credit ratings accordingly
  • Consult with colleagues regarding financial analysis and credit risk evaluation related matters concerning financial institutions
  • Participate in various projects related to the improvement of the rating systems and processes
